About Cabling Installation & Maintenance

Our mission: Bringing practical business and technical intelligence to today's structured cabling professionals

For more than 30 years, Cabling Installation & Maintenance has provided useful, practical information to professionals responsible for the specification, design, installation and management of structured cabling systems serving enterprise, data center and other environments. These professionals are challenged to stay informed of constantly evolving standards, system-design and installation approaches, product and system capabilities, technologies, as well as applications that rely on high-performance structured cabling systems. Our editors synthesize these complex issues into multiple information products. This portfolio of information products provides concrete detail that improves the efficiency of day-to-day operations, and equips cabling professionals with the perspective that enables strategic planning for networks’ optimum long-term performance.

Throughout our annual magazine, weekly email newsletters and 24/7/365 website, Cabling Installation & Maintenance digs into the essential topics our audience focuses on.

  • Design, Installation and Testing: We explain the bottom-up design of cabling systems, from case histories of actual projects to solutions for specific problems or aspects of the design process. We also look at specific installations using a case-history approach to highlight challenging problems, solutions and unique features. Additionally, we examine evolving test-and-measurement technologies and techniques designed to address the standards-governed and practical-use performance requirements of cabling systems.
  • Technology: We evaluate product innovations and technology trends as they impact a particular product class through interviews with manufacturers, installers and users, as well as contributed articles from subject-matter experts.
  • Data Center: Cabling Installation & Maintenance takes an in-depth look at design and installation workmanship issues as well as the unique technology being deployed specifically for data centers.
  • Physical Security: Focusing on the areas in which security and IT—and the infrastructure for both—interlock and overlap, we pay specific attention to Internet Protocol’s influence over the development of security applications.
  • Standards: Tracking the activities of North American and international standards-making organizations, we provide updates on specifications that are in-progress, looking forward to how they will affect cabling-system design and installation. We also produce articles explaining the practical aspects of designing and installing cabling systems in accordance with the specifications of established standards.

Reliant Has Your Back When Summer Temps Climb

With 48 Beat the Heat Centers statewide, $200 in bonus bill credits and tools to manage energy usage, Reliant has resources for every Texan

As summer settles in, millions of residents across Texas are reaching for the thermostat. Whether you’re someone who is managing a set monthly budget, needs a safe place to cool off or simply want more transparency in your energy usage, Reliant has a simple message this summer: we have your back.

“As we prepare for another hot Texas summer, Reliant is keeping the safety and comfort of our customers and the community top of mind. It’s important to us that we’re more than just an electricity provider,” said Andrea Russell, senior vice president, Reliant. “As part of our commitment to communities throughout Texas, we’re providing a range of energy assistance, opening 48 Beat the Heat Centers and offering innovative digital tools to empower customers to manage their energy use more efficiently this summer.”

Beat the Heat Centers and Keeping Cool at Home

In partnership with local health departments, city governments and nonprofit organizations, Reliant is opening 48 Beat the Heat cooling centers in Houston, Dallas, Fort Worth, Corpus Christi and Lubbock over the next few weeks. These centers provide a safe space for seniors and vulnerable residents to cool off and decrease their energy usage at home. Further, Reliant is donating more than $180,000 across Texas, which helps fund the distribution of 1,000 cooling devices, including portable air conditioners, air coolers and boxed fans, for residents to stay safe at home. Savor Summer with Two Days of Free Electricity Every Week

The Flextra Credits plan conveniently provides customers with free electricity on their two highest-use days every week (up to 8 free days a month), as well as $200 total in bonus bill credits that can be redeemed over the length of their term. This plan is powered by 100% solar and was built to adapt to busy lifestyles and changing summer schedules, while also providing relief when customers need it most.

Financial Assistance to Help Neighbors in Need

Reliant is also providing financial assistance and support to its customers through the Community Assistance by Reliant Energy (CARE) program. This program helps customers facing financial hardship by connecting them with social service agencies for assistance. Reliant’s 24/7 award-winning customer care team can help customers determine if they qualify for CARE or if other assistance options, like payment plans, extensions or Average Monthly Billing, are a better fit. Savings Power Pack

Throughout the summer months when increased usage is common, Reliant’s Savings Power Pack provides customers with the tools they need to manage their electricity costs, including:

  • The award-winning Reliant App helps customers stay informed of usage and costs and take proactive measures to reduce, conserve and save. The app empowers customers to actively manage and adjust their habits with real-time bill projections, insightful trends and usage comparisons. Solar and EV customers also have enhanced experiences to manage their production and control the charging of their vehicle.
  • Customers can sign up for Degrees of Difference to help conserve energy during peak usage times. Customers receive a bill credit for enrolling in the Smart Thermostats program, which can help reduce energy usage by adjusting smart thermostat temperatures by no more than four degrees. Reliant’s program is compatible with Google Nest, Honeywell Home and Emerson Sensi thermostats. Customers always remain in control and can manually adjust their temperature if needed.
